Files
vedant-chavan/app/Models/SubscriptionPlanPackage.php

37 lines
884 B
PHP
Raw Permalink Normal View History

2024-06-12 20:29:05 +05:30
<?php
namespace App\Models;
use Illuminate\Database\Eloquent\Factories\HasFactory;
use Illuminate\Database\Eloquent\Model;
use Illuminate\Database\Eloquent\SoftDeletes;
use App\Models\SubscriptionPackageDescription;
use App\Models\SubscriptionMaster;
class SubscriptionPlanPackage extends Model
{
use HasFactory;
use SoftDeletes;
protected $dates = ['deleted_at'];
protected $table = 'subscription_plan_packages';
protected $fillable = [
'subscription_master_id',
'plan_period',
'plan_price',
'currency_type',
'is_active'
];
public function SubscriptionMaster() {
return $this->belongsTo(SubscriptionMaster::class,'plan_id');
}
public function subscription_package_descriptions() {
return $this->hasOne(SubscriptionPackageDescription::class, 'plan_id');
}
}